Marina Oaks - streets of Mandeville (Louisiana).
Explore "Marina Oaks" on the map of Mandeville in street view mode
Click on the buttons below to display the map of Marina Oaks, Mandeville, United States
Search street by name:
Tags:
Marina Oaks on the map of Mandeville,
Mandeville satellite view, Mandeville street view.